Yep! That article holds true for Blondes. Last year I caught a blonde just outside the harbour while fishing for congers! The Bank is certainly the best place to go and I would start out fishing the start of the flood! They are more fickle now than previously.
If there is lots of whiting in the harbour (And there is now) then fishing with bait for blondes can be a frustrating exercise. The bait robbers will drive you scatty and will hamper your chances of hooking up the target species.
